6. Bankroll Management for Rapid Play

When sessions are short, keeping track of how much you’re willing to spend becomes critical. A common strategy among quick‑play enthusiasts is to allocate a fixed percentage of your bankroll per session—say 5%—and stick to it strictly.

If your bankroll is €200, you’d set aside €10 per session for quick spins and table hands. This disciplined approach prevents overspending while still allowing enough room for multiple wins or losses in those brief bursts.

Session Budget Breakdown

  1. Total bankroll: €200
  2. Session budget (5%): €10
  3. Slot bet per spin: €1 – allows up to ten spins per session.
  4. Table bet per hand: €2 – gives five hands if you switch from slots mid‑session.

By using this simple structure you can keep sessions short while still managing risk effectively.
